Semaglutide, marketed as Wegovy for weight loss, also plays a significant role in metabolic health, which is intrinsically linked to diabetes. Obesity is a major risk factor for type 2 diabetes, and by promoting weight loss, semaglutide can indirectly improve insulin sensitivity and reduce the risk of developing the condition. For individuals struggling with obesity, semaglutide offers a pathway to improved glycemic control and a lower likelihood of developing diabetes is佛历2568年1月15日—A first randomized clinical trial shows thatsemaglutide use in type 1 diabetes is associated with improved glucose management, weight loss and lower insulin ....
